Technical Expertise & Material Science

The engineering behind a Wine Ki Botal involves sophisticated thermal dynamics. At our state-of-the-art facility, we utilize automated I.S. (Individual Section) machines that can produce thousands of units per hour with tolerances measured in microns. Our annealing lehrs ensure that internal stresses are completely eliminated, preventing breakage during the high-speed filling processes used by modern bottling plants.

By utilizing borosilicate and soda-lime glass variants, we cater to different shelf-life requirements and chemical sensitivities of the beverage. Global Trends in Glass Packaging (2024-2030)

The "Premiumization" trend is sweeping the global market. Buyers are moving away from generic plastic toward 100% recyclable glass. In the context of Wine Ki Botal manufacturing in China, this means a shift toward heavy-base designs, intricate embossing, and internal fluting.

1. Digital Printing vs. Paper Labels: We are seeing a 40% increase in demand for direct-to-glass digital printing. This tech allows for high-resolution graphics that don't peel in ice buckets.

2. The Rise of the 375ml "Half-Bottle": As consumer habits shift toward mindful drinking, the demand for 375ml glass gin and wine bottles has spiked. Our production lines are optimized for quick mold changes to accommodate these smaller runs.

What is the Minimum Order Quantity (MOQ) for custom designs?

For custom-molded glass bottles, our MOQ typically starts at 20,000 units. However, for stocked items (like our classic Bordeaux or Spirit bottles), we can accommodate smaller orders starting at one full pallet.

Are your glass bottles FDA and SGS certified?

Yes. All our glass packaging undergoes rigorous testing for lead and cadmium leaching. We are fully compliant with FDA (USA), LFGB (Germany), and other international food-grade standards, ensuring your beverage remains pure and untainted.

How do you prevent breakage during international shipping?

We use heavy-duty corrugated dividers, custom-fit pallets, and shrink-wrapping with corner protectors. Our breakage rate for trans-oceanic shipping is consistently below 0.5%.
